Output 42db281da5536f389fa4e8e89a67c2998295e6a885748867cde9113e57fcbc65:1

value
27664390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fdd44a7a71fb571445d1fa1f02c39bf9b12ff9d OP_EQUAL
address
MGe3Vdu1zNstp1i6mxwUVm7UBq3kV4hZ2A
transaction
42db281da5536f389fa4e8e89a67c2998295e6a885748867cde9113e57fcbc65
spent
true